Bunker Demand Soars Amid Global Tensions

The current global geopolitical climate is driving a surge in demand for personal bunkers, according to industry sources. BSSD Defence, a German manufacturer specializing in protective structures, reports a 50% increase in inquiries since the beginning of the year.

Company CEO Mario Piejde indicated that a significant portion of these requests – over half – originate from businesses and landlords. “Companies are contacting us to install bunkers on their premises as a safety measure for their employees” Piejde stated.

Landlords are also showing increased interest in providing shelter options for their tenants. The recent incidents involving Russian military drone activity near Polish airspace have notably fueled these inquiries. “People are realizing that the situation is serious” Piejde commented.

The German Protection Room Centre in Munich has corroborated this trend, confirming a substantial rise in demand for consultations regarding small bunkers. “We’ve seen a marked increase in requests for advice, particularly following the recent events in Poland” said a spokesperson for the centre. The escalating international tensions are evidently prompting individuals and organizations to explore options for personal protection.
